Samsung TV Plus Expands AsiaPac Operations

ADVERTISEMENT

Brigitte Slattery has been appointed as the head of Samsung TV Plus in the Asia Pacific, tapped to oversee its regional content slate, operations and marketing as it scales its presence in the region.

Samsung TV Plus is available in Australia, India, New Zealand, the Philippines, Singapore and Thailand. Slattery, who previously held roles at Network Ten, Foxtel, HBO and NBCUniversal, reports to Salek Brodsky, senior VP and general manager of Samsung TV Plus.

Samantha Cooke has been named head of marketing and analytics at Samsung Ads Southeast Asia and Oceania, with a remit to drive gains with clients. Virgile Edragas has expanded his role to head of data and analytics in the region and Alex Smith joins from Nielsen.

“The remarkable growth of ad-supported TV underscores the immense potential for advertisers to reach highly engaged audiences through streaming,” said Alex Spurzem, managing director of Samsung Ads in Southeast Asia and Oceania (SEAO). “These leadership appointments are a testament to both the team’s achievements to date and the huge opportunities still ahead for brands and advertisers.”

Slattery added, “Audiences still love watching TV channels—the only difference is now they are streaming it. We’ve made the free TV experience easier and instant, so when you switch on a Samsung TV, you’ve got a great mix of both local and global premium content ready to go.”
